Expert response:
Eraser does have 41% Glyphosate, but you can alter the amount used per gallon of water for different plants. Tough plants such as ivy or other vines will require higher percentages of glyphosate. If the targeted plants are not actively growing, then it will take longer for the glyphosate to translocate throughout the plant.

Eraser Weed Killer
By Betty on 06/22/2011
Eraser is the best weed killer we have ever used. We have used many types and brands of weed killer over the years but most were expensive and a waste of money, time, and energy as they were ineffective. Vegetation sprayed with Eraser takes about a week to wither and die. Certain plants, depending on type, size, and age, may require a second application, but this stuff works. It even kills poison oak that is climbing up a tree trunk without killing the tree. Just don't get it on the leaves of the tree. Do not use if the wind is blowing because if mist drifts onto something you do not wish to kill, it will die. Eraser is easy to mix and use. It kills vegetation that it is sprayed on but does not "kill" the soil. Desired plants can be grown there later. It is my understanding that Eraser does NOT leach into ground water – that degradation of this product is primarily a biological process carried out by soil microbes.
